General note
53-4725_003, 53-4725_005 and photo missing from envelope appeared on Page 3 of the Monday, January 19, 1953 edition of the newspaper as part of the article: "RCEs Flatten Glue Plant Smokestack".

General note
Glue factory smoke stack was located at West Ave. and Victoria St.
